The price of acquiring a Polish motorist's license can differ substantially depending upon several elements, consisting of the category of the license, the driving school picked, the expenses of lessons, and extra certifications required. Below is a comprehensive breakdown of the expenses associated with acquiring a classification B chauffeur's license, which is the most typical.

Table 2: Costs Associated with a Polish Category B Driver's License

Cost ComponentApproximate Cost (PLN)Driving School Enrollment2,000 - 3,000Theoretical Examination Fee30Practical Examination Fee200Medical Examination200 - 300Vision Test30Issuance of Driver's License100Overall Estimated Cost2,560 - 3,660

Keep in mind: Costs can vary based on the city, the school's track record, and offered offerings.

Extra Costs

Beyond the fundamental costs laid out above, there are likewise potential extra expenses to consider:

  • Driving Lessons: If you need more lessons than what is included in the driving school bundle, fees can increase substantially. Extra classes might vary from 100 PLN to 200 PLN each.

  • Study Materials: Purchase of textbooks and online resources for theoretical research study can cost another 100 PLN to 300 PLN.

  • Retaking Exams: If you don't pass the theory or practical tests on your very first effort, retake costs may apply.

Total Estimated Costs for Full Process

Thinking about the extra factors, a detailed cost range for obtaining a Polish classification B driver's license might increase to around 5,000 PLN in total if several lessons and retakes are needed.

Factors Influencing Prices

Several elements can influence the overall cost of acquiring a chauffeur's license in Poland. These consist of:

  1. Location: Prices might be greater in big cities (like Warsaw and Kraków) compared to smaller sized towns.

  2. Driving School Reputation: More credible schools may charge greater costs but frequently offer superior training and success rates.

  3. Period of Lessons: Individual requires might vary, necessitating more lessons, which directly impacts costs.

  4. Kind Of Vehicle Used in Training: Specialized training vehicles (like automatic vehicles) may sustain extra charges.

  5. Health and Vision Checks: These might vary in costs throughout various service companies.
